#19: Leyla sits down with Stephanie Sikora, best selling author, life coach, systems specialist, and professional organizer. Stephanie offers home organization services throughout the U.S., virtual coaching, and on-line resources for busy individuals and households.\\xa0

This episode is for you if you\\u2019ve been feeling defeated, unmotivated, and in a constant state of chaos due to how cluttered and unorganized your space is. Stephanie really breaks down how our brain works on clutter- and spoiler alert, it\\u2019s not pretty!\\xa0

I want you to be more present in your home and life. Constant clutter makes me feel frazzled, hopeless, unmotivated...the list goes on\\u2026 but it never really occurred to me that my clutter and disorganization could be one of the underlying causes of why I\\u2019m not doing the things I want to be doing in life. This episode offers some insights into how this is affecting our brain, and how we can make significant improvements in our day to day lives.\\xa0
